How to Get a Proper Visa to Study in China

The very first thing you need to do before leaving for studying in China is to get an X Visa (Student Visa). How?

Step 1: Receive original Admission Letter and JW202 form from your Chinese university
Once you are admitted by the university, your school will send you the above two documents. You will need to submit the originals of these two documents along with other required documents to the nearest Chinese consulate or embassy to apply for your X visa.



Step 2: Do physical examination and get your Physical Examination Record
All students who will apply for an X Visa need to do a physical examination before applying for visa. In most cases, you must submit the completed original physical examination record when you start to apply your X visa. More…


Step 3: Go to the nearest Chinese embassy or consulate to apply for an XVisa
Chinese visas are classified based on your purpose for being in China, such as tourism, education, or employment. For international students who intend to study in China for longer than 6 months, an X visa is the most secured choice.



Documents needed for visa application:

A valid passport with at least six months remaining validity and at least one blank visa page in it;
Chinese visa application form: accurately, completely, and clearly filled out and signed.
